NELFINAVIR ORAL POWDER
(nell-FIN-uh-veer)
COMMON BRAND NAME(S): Viracept
USES: This medication belongs to a class of drugs called protease inhibitors and is used in combination with other drgus to treat HIV infection.
HOW TO USE: Take exactly as directed with a meal or lgiht snack. The powder may be mxied with a small amount of water, milk, formula, soy formula, soy milk or diet supplement. Once mixed, drink the entire mixtrue to receive the full dose. Mixture with acidic food or juice (e.G., orange juice, apple juice or apple sauce) is not recommended for a bitter taste may reslut. Use the powder mixture immediately after preparatoin. Otherwise, sotre the mixture in the refrigerator and use within 6 hours. Do not heat the mixed dose once it has been prepaerd. Note: Do not mix with wtaer in the original nelfinavir container.
It is critical to take that meidcation every day exactly as prescribed.
Do not interrupt treatment unlses directed to do so by your doctor. Do not take more than prescribed.
SIDE EFFECTS: The majority of side effects were mild. Diarrhea, stomach pain, nausea, dizziness or gas might occur. If these continue or are bothersome, notify your dotcor. Unlikely, but report any of the following effects: persistent sore throat or fever, rash, yellowing of the eyes or skin, vision problems, increased urination or thirst, unusual fatigue. Very unlikely but report immediately any allergic reaction while taking that mdeication. Symptoms include: difficulty breathing, itching, fever, swelling. If you notice other effects not listed above, contact your doctor or pharmacist.
PRECAUTIONS: Befroe taking that drug, tell your doctor if you have: liver disease, any allergies (especially drug allergies), blood disorders (hemophilia), phenylketonuria, diabetes. Tell your doctor if you're pregnant befroe taking that medication. It is not known whehter that drug is excreted into human milk. HIV-infected mothers are advised to avoid breast-feeding in order to protect the infant from becoming infected with HIV. Patients taking birth control pills should use a different or additional method of birth control during treatment with nelfinavir.
Caution is advised if that drug is used in kids udner 2 years of age.
DRUG INTERACTIONS: This drug should not be used with the following medications cause very serious interactions may occur: amiodarone, cisapride, midazolam, triazolam, pimozide, ergot derivaitves (e.G., ergotamine, dihydroergotamine), rifampin, quinidine, terfenadine, astemizole, eletriptan, "statin" drugs (e.G., lovastatin, simvastatin). If you're currently using any of these medications, tell your docotr or pharmacist before starting nelfinavir. Tell your dotcor of all nonprescription and prescription medication you may take, especially: rifabutin, carbamazepine, garlic supplements, caspofungin, sildenafil, delavirdine, nevirapine, phenobarbital, phenytoin, drugs which suppress the immune system (e.G., cyclosporine, sirolimus, tacrolimus), methadone, azithromycin, other protease inhibitors (e.G., indinavir, ritonavir, saquinavir), St John's wort. This drug may interfere with the effectiveness of birth control pills. Discuss usnig other methods of birth control with your doctor. Do not start or stop any medicine without docotr or pharmacist approval.
OVERDOSE: If overdose is suspected, contact your local poison control center or emergency room immediately.
NOTES: This medication does not cure HIV infection. Patients treated with nelfinavir may continue to acquire "opportunistic" infections associated with HIV. This medication also does not prevent transmission of HIV to others through sexual cnotact or blood. Do not share that medication with otehrs.
MISSED DOSE: If you miss a dose, take it as soon as you remember. If it is near the time of the next dose, skip the missed dose and resume your usual dosing scheudle. Do not "double-up" the dose to ctach up.
STORAGE: Store at room temperature between 59 and 86 degrees F (15-30 degrees C) away from lihgt and moisture. Once mixed, use nelfinavir powedr immediately. Otherwise, store the powder mixture in the refrigeartor and use within 6 hours.
